PORTUGUESE STYLE POT ROASTED CHICKEN
INGREDIENTS
14½ OUNCE CAN DICED FIRE-ROASTED TOMATOES
1 CUP TAWNY PORT OR BRANDY (SEE NOTE)
1½ TEASPOONS SMOKED PAPRIKA
4 OUNCES THICK-CUT BACON, CHOPPED
3 POUNDS BONE-IN, SKIN ON CHICKEN THIGHS, LEG QUARTERS OR BREASTS (SEE NOTE)
1 TBLS MINCED GARLIC
KOSHER SALT AND GROUND BLACK PEPPER
1 BUNCH FRESH CILANTRO OR PARSLEY, CHOPPED
NOTE: Can Use Boneless Chicken As Well
DIRECTIONS
In a large Dutch oven, stir the tomatoes with juices, port, paprika and bacon. Generously season the chicken with salt and pepper, then nestle skin up in the pot.
Heat the oven to 400°F. Roast, uncovered, until the dark meat reaches 175°F or white meat reaches 160°F, about 50 minutes.
Transfer the chicken to a serving dish. Stir the herb into the sauce, then season with salt and pepper. Spoon around the chicken.
